The Instructional Services Department provides curriculum support and professional development services to approximately 280 teachers employed by the district. The key to an effective instructional program is the teacher in the classroom. Armed with this knowledge the Instructional Services Department has created curriculum committees to designate, plan and deliver curriculum support and in-service training for our faculty, certificated and classified.
The Sulphur Springs School District is committed to maintaining and developing its highly skilled and effective teaching force. The close working relationship enjoyed by the district with many local teaching colleges provides the district with an active pool of highly qualified candidates to fill the ever increasing demand within the teaching field.
